Managing Cognitive Load in Content Design

Magic EdTech

All these cases hint at information overload. Cognitive load theory in Instructional Design comes to the rescue. The theory was proposed by John Sweller in 1988 and is built on the way the human mind processes information. Let us understand how the human brain processes information.

Learning Science: The Coherence Principle Decoded

Mike Taylor

A Tale of Cognitive Overload Your learners’ brains are not infinite vessels; they have a limit on how much they can process at a given time, a concept explored by cognitive load theory. The trick is to use images that serve as cognitive aids and are directly relevant to the material at hand. Build wisely.
